    tappings required by the pressure sensors‚ additional tappings are included in the ducts to allow appropriate calibration instruments to be connected. The flow of air through the compressor is regulated by a throttle control device installed at the exit of the discharge duct. Rotation of the collar opens and closes a variable aperture which allows the head/flow produced by the compressor to be varied.     retains a pressure that is constant between defining limits during both static and dynamic situations. In this context‚ ‘constant’ refers to maintaining a pressure that is continually within the margins of the drilling window. Typically within CBHP MPD operations‚ an automated system such as Weatherford’s Microflux Control system is used to measure and apply the required level of surface backpressure. Boyles law relates pressure and volume while all other factors are consistent and states: for a fixed amount of gas kept at constant temp‚ the product of the pressure of the gas and its volume will remain constant if either quantity is changed‚ or where k is constant. THE GAS LAWS Boyle’s Law At constant temperature‚ the pressure of a fixed amount of gas is inversely proportional to its volume.
